Problem
Bank fraud and risk teams have to translate business policy into rule logic, evolve those rules as fraud patterns change, and prove the new version of a rule is safer than the one already live — before it ships. In legacy stacks every rule change is an engineering ticket. That makes the team slow, the rules brittle, and the cost of a bad change high enough that people stop changing them.
QuantRule’s bet was that the risk team should be able to build, version, and publish workflows themselves — visually, with rule atoms instead of code, and with a backtest in front of every publish so they can show the bank what the change is actually going to do.

Publish — the part that earns trust
The publish flow is a four-step modal: Summary of changes, Impact analysis, Approvals, Deployment. Impact analysis is the one that matters. Side-by-side: how the proposed rule would have decided historical traffic vs. how the prior version actually decided it — approved, rejected, investigated, all three counts. Above the comparison, an orange disclaimer: “Estimates are provided using backtesting, and may not perfectly reflect future performance.” That line is the difference between a backtest people trust and one they ignore.

Alternatives considered
- A form-based rule editor instead of a node graphForms hide how a decision actually flows. A visual node graph makes the pipeline legible to a non-engineer — the whole reason for handing rules to the risk team in the first place.
- A simple “are you sure?” publish confirmA blind confirm trains people to publish at random. Putting proposed-vs-prior backtests side by side, with an honest disclaimer about the estimate, is what makes the next version trustworthy.
- A full permission system in the MVPTempting, but it would have blown the launch window. Rollout was limited to a small set of users for v1, with the richer permission model deferred — visible version history covered the immediate safety need.

Reflection
The single best decision in this design is the backtest in the publish flow. Risk-rule systems live or die on whether the people running them trust the next version more than the current one. A publish flow that puts proposed-vs-prior side by side, with an honest disclaimer about the limits of the estimate, is the difference between a tool people use and one they route around.
The piece I’d push further is the Approvals step inside that same publish flow — only the stepper title is visible in the current screens. Who approves, parallel vs. serial approvers, what happens when one rejects, how an approval escalates past a deadline — all of that is the next thing I’d ship.
What I’d keep. The inline ruleset panel. Most rule editors send you to a modal or a separate page when you start configuring — fine for the first rule, miserable from the second on. Expanding under the graph lets the operator hold the workflow and the rule in the same mental frame.
